@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_passNodeStates = capsule.readSavableList("passNodeStates", null);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_camera = (Camera) capsule.readSavable("camera", null);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_camera = (Camera) capsule.readSavable("camera", null);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_passNodeStates = capsule.readSavableList("passNodeStates", null);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_length = capsule.readDouble("length", 1); _width = capsule.readDouble("width", .25);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_length = capsule.readDouble("length", 1); _width = capsule.readDouble("width", .25);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); length = capsule.readDouble("length", 1); width = capsule.readDouble("width", 0.125); rightHanded = capsule.readBoolean("rightHanded", true); buildAxis(); }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); length = capsule.readDouble("length", 1); width = capsule.readDouble("width", 0.125); rightHanded = capsule.readBoolean("rightHanded", true); buildAxis(); }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_xExtent = capsule.readFloat("xExtent", 0); _yExtent = capsule.readFloat("yExtent", 0); _zExtent = capsule.readFloat("zExtent", 0); _skyboxQuads = CapsuleUtils.asArray(capsule.readSavableArray("skyboxQuads", null), Quad.class);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_xExtent = capsule.readFloat("xExtent", 0); _yExtent = capsule.readFloat("yExtent", 0); _zExtent = capsule.readFloat("zExtent", 0); _skyboxQuads = CapsuleUtils.asArray(capsule.readSavableArray("skyboxQuads", null), Quad.class);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_texture = (Texture2D) capsule.readSavable("texture", null); _targetScene = (Node) capsule.readSavable("targetScene", null); _imposterQuad = (Quad) capsule.readSavable("standIn", new Quad("ImposterQuad")); _redrawRate = capsule.readFloat("redrawRate", 0.05f); _cameraAngleThreshold = capsule.readFloat("cameraThreshold", 0); _worldUpVector = (Vector3) capsule.readSavable("worldUpVector", new Vector3(Vector3.UNIT_Y)); }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_texture = (Texture2D) capsule.readSavable("texture", null); _targetScene = (Node) capsule.readSavable("targetScene", null); _imposterQuad = (Quad) capsule.readSavable("standIn", new Quad("ImposterQuad")); _redrawRate = capsule.readFloat("redrawRate", 0.05f); _cameraAngleThreshold = capsule.readFloat("cameraThreshold", 0); _worldUpVector = (Vector3) capsule.readSavable("worldUpVector", new Vector3(Vector3.UNIT_Y)); }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_orient.set((Matrix3) capsule.readSavable("orient", new Matrix3(Matrix3.IDENTITY))); _look.set((Vector3) capsule.readSavable("look", new Vector3(Vector3.ZERO))); _left.set((Vector3) capsule.readSavable("left", new Vector3(Vector3.ZERO))); _alignment = capsule.readEnum("alignment", BillboardAlignment.class, BillboardAlignment.ScreenAligned);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_orient.set((Matrix3) capsule.readSavable("orient", new Matrix3(Matrix3.IDENTITY))); _look.set((Vector3) capsule.readSavable("look", new Vector3(Vector3.ZERO))); _left.set((Vector3) capsule.readSavable("left", new Vector3(Vector3.ZERO))); _alignment = capsule.readEnum("alignment", BillboardAlignment.class, BillboardAlignment.ScreenAligned); _updateBounds = capsule.readBoolean("updateBounds", true); } }
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_particleType = capsule.readEnum("particleType", ParticleType.class, ParticleType.Quad); _particleEmitter = (SavableParticleEmitter) capsule.readSavable("particleEmitter", null);
@Override public void read(final InputCapsule capsule) throws IOException { super.read(capsule); _particleType = capsule.readEnum("particleType", ParticleType.class, ParticleType.Triangle); _particleEmitter = (SavableParticleEmitter) capsule.readSavable("particleEmitter", null);